Step 01: - Deploy Azure Kubernetes Service in Subscription. After filling in this form, you can click on the Create Cluster button. Build, deploy and manage your applications across cloud- and on-premise infrastructure Red Hat OpenShift Container Platform At the time of its launch in December 2015, OpenShift Dedicated ran only on AWS In OpenShift, an environment is a project residing in a cluster In doing so we'll enable the success of customers, users, partners, and contributors as In doing so . Kubernetes is a powerful open-source system, initially developed by Google, for managing containerized applications in a clustered environment. There are step-by-step instructions in the Learn panel on the right side of the Cloud Console to guide you. Once this command finishes, it displays a kubeadm join message. Wait for the system to download the Nginx image and start the POD. As a final step, we will deploy a sample application and demonstrate how to use Keycloak as an Identity Provider . Copy to Clipboard. This tutorial takes you on the journey of writing your first Kubernetes Operator using Kubernetes Operator SDK 1.11+. The master node maintains the current state of the Kubernetes cluster and configuration in the etcd, a key value store database, at all times. Welcome to my Istio step-by-step tutorial series. By creating a namespace, a grouping method inside Kubernetes, you allow services, pods, controllers, and volumes to easily work together while isolating them from other parts of the cluster. Repeat the process on each server that will act as a node. Step4: Create a K8s Deployment to Deploy Tomcat on Kubernetes. Kubernetes Ingress is a resource to add rules to route traffic from external sources to the applications running in the kubernetes cluster. Securing postfix (postfix-2 Postfix Admin is a web based interface to configure and manage a Postfix based email server for many users In this article we are going to configure Postfix to relay mail through an external SMTP server The key options in the main For email notifications in such CI systems, one option is to reuse postfix service, which is usually . Initialize a cluster by executing the following command: sudo kubeadm init --pod-network-cidr=10.244../16. Setting Up Cert-Manager: a step-by-step tutorial. Step3: list the nodes of the cluster. It aims to provide better ways of managing related, distributed components, and services across the varied infrastructure. Kubespray is a composition of Ansible playbooks, inventory, provisioning tools, and domain knowledge for generic OS/Kubernetes clusters configuration management tasks. As the definition says, Kubernetes or k8s is an open-source orchestration and cluster management for container-based applications maintained by the Cloud Native Computing Foundation. Search: Openshift Tutorial. FREE Tutorials - https://automationstepbystep.com/Step 1 - Add new instanceStep 2 - Initialize master nodeStep 3 - Add another instancekubectl get nodeskubec. We can have.
Step 3: Generate SSH key for ansible (only need to run on ansible node .i.e. Learn DevOps with our step by step guides on various DevOps tools like AWS Cloud, Google Cloud Platform, Jenkins, Ansible, SonarQube, Git, Docker, Kubernetes etc. In this walkthrough you'll do the following: Create a Kubernetes Engine cluster. In this step, we will initialize the kubernetes master cluster configuration. Select the region, provide the service name and resource group, and then click Create. Kubernetes Tutorial - A Beginners Guide Kubernetes, an open-source technology, has rapidly become the leading container orchestration system. Kubernetes is initialized on the controller node; let's do it. kubeadm init --apiserver-advertise-address=10..15.10 --pod-network-cidr=10.244../16. Kubespray provides: a .
. Next, install Docker with the command: sudo apt-get install docker.io. It is not, however, a collection of instances. The next step to getting started with Kubernetes is deploying apps and workloads. Container image signatures will be stored in Grafeas. Helm helps manage the required state of multiple Kubernetes objects. Set up GitOps on Azure Arc through the Azure portal. By the end of this step, we should have three clusters running in three different regions of the Digital Ocean cloud platform. In this guide, we will cover how to install Kubernetes Cluster on Ubuntu 20.04 LTS Server (Focal Fossa) using kubeadm utility.
How to learn DevOps. Tutorials are classified into the following categories: . June 30, 2020. What you'll do. A Kubernetes Operator manages your application's logistics. $ sudo apt-get update $ sudo apt-get install apt-transport-https ca-certificates.
This should change in the next step. Getting started with Azure Kubernetes Services - Step by Step - 1 18 August 2019 on Hosting & Cloud, Microsoft Azure, Kubernetes. Let's begin by launching the Kubernetes clusters with doctl CLI. Architecture upgrades in the Kubernetes Operator SDK (in version 0.20) put that article out of date. DevOps Flow What is Continuous Integration? Kubernetes.io defines Kubernetes as an open-source system for automating deployment, scaling, and management of containerized applications. Grafeas Tutorial. The path Helm took to solve this issue was to create Helm Charts.
2. You can find a library APIs in the API library, just search name. Related: Step-by-Step Tutorial: Installing Kubernetes on Ubuntu. A Kubernetes cluster is made up of a number of nodes. Once the clusters are provisioned, we will download kubeconfig and rename the context. In this tutorial, How to create DevOps CI/CD pipelines using Git, Jenkins, Ansible, Docker, and Kubernetes on AWS.
Step-1: Basic Configuration. Go to your console (console button at the right upper corner).
kubernetes is an open source container orchestration framework. Get started with Amazon Elastic Kubernetes Service (EKS), a managed service that makes it easy for you to run Kubernetes containers on AWS and on-premises. Kubernetes is a complex system, and learning step by step is the best way to gain expertise.
The first option is to use the Azure portal via the Kubernetes resource we connected, and then navigate to Settings > GitOps > Add Configuration.
Search: Deploy Keycloak In Kubernetes. With your app or workload deployed, the last step to getting started with Kubernetes is organizing themand determining who or what has access to them. The next step to getting started with Kubernetes is deploying apps and workloads.
This tutorial will guide you through testing Grafeas. Install Jenkins X on Google Kubernetes Engine (GKE) Log into your Google cloud account. Those resources are Kubernetes objects like . If you do not have Kubernetes, install it by following these steps: 1. Step-5: Add Tags. Step 2 - Kubernetes Cluster Initialization. - kmaster, kworker.
It is a fantastic book for someone like me who needs a break from reading random blog posts.
The application is pretty straightforward, a text input with a single button that you can add the text input to the database and another button that you can delete all the words in the database. Step 05: - Run the application on our AKS Cluster. Step-4: Listeners and Routing. Make sure that the apt package is working. Search: Openshift Tutorial. The application is pretty straightforward, a text input with a single button that you can add the text input to the database and another button that you can delete all the words in the database. Choose a name: You can name your cluster whatever you want (e.g., "kubernetes-tutorial"). Click here to return to Amazon Web Services homepage. Rather than defining and explaining the basics of K8s, this post intends to quickly get you up to speed with AKS. Step 03: - Integration of AKS with Azure Container Registry. There are two methods to set up GitOps on an Azure Arc-enabled cluster. In our example, we created a POD named TEST. Use this interactive walkthrough to learn how to deploy a sample application using Autopilot mode in Google Kubernetes Engine (GKE). Included in the resources below are many coding examples and step-by-step projects. Step 02: - Configure Networking in AKS Deployment. To run pods with your containerized apps and workloads, you'll describe a new desired state to the cluster in the form . Create a POD using the Nginx image. Step-by-step guides. Source: Kubernetes. Step 1: Create Cluster with kubeadm. Kubernetes on AWS: Step-By-Step Tutorial for Deployment Learn how to deploy, manage, and scale containerized applications using Kubernetes on AWS 3.9 (40 ratings) 292 students Created by Packt Publishing Last updated 7/2018 English English [Auto] $159.99 $199.99 20% off 5 hours left at this price! Step 4 Add the new GPG key. Step 1: Log on to the machine with the root user account. Kubernetes is an open-source tool for automating deployment, scaling, and managing containerized applications. The below command tells Kubernetes the IP address where its kube-apiserver is located with the --apiserver-advertise-address parameter. Conclusion. Step 04: - Connect to AKS cluster using VS Code. Pending Pods - created but not . In this tutorial, we explore basic and advanced concepts as well as various tools and Kubernetes management platforms.
The server communicates the information and instructions to the client. In it, you will create a Kubernetes cluster configured to only allow container images signed by a specific key, configurable via a configmap. This is a single node cluster. Build and deploy a Docker image on Kubernetes using Tekton Pipelines. The first step in deploying a Kubernetes cluster is to fire up the master node. For an easy and quick installation of Kubernetes on AWS try the open source tool eksctl and with only one command have a fully functional Kubernetes cluster running in AWS' EKS in minutes. Contact Us Support English My Account . Create Kubernetes custom resource definitions . A Docker works via a Docker engine that consists of two key elements: a server and a client. In this tutorial, we have set up a Kubernetes cluster already, so choose the option Link a Kubernetes cluster on IBM Cloud and click Let's get setup!.
Prerequisites We assume anyone who wants to understand Kubernetes should have an understating of how the Docker works, how the Docker images are created, and how they work as a standalone unit.
Step6: List the pods created by the deployment. Today's web users never tolerate interruption. Step7: ScaleUP the deployment. Step 3 Run the following commands. Here are the essential Kubernetes features: Automated Scheduling Self-Healing Capabilities Automated rollouts & rollback Horizontal Scaling & Load Balancing Offers environment consistency for development, testing, and production Infrastructure is loosely coupled to each component can act as a separate unit
3. Same is true of Kubernetes. The next step to getting started with Kubernetes is deploying apps and workloads. Step 5: Install python3-pip (only need to run on ansible node .i.e. The master node maintains the current state of the Kubernetes cluster and configuration in the etcd, a key value store database, at all times. Step 4: Create a POD with local persistent Volume. amaster) Step 6: Clone the kubespray git repo (only need to run on ansible node .i.e. Step 03 - Creating Kubernetes Cluster with Google Kubernete Engine (GKE) Step 04 - Review Kubernetes Cluster and Learn Few Fun Facts about Kubernetes; Step 05 - Deploy Your First Spring Boot Application to Kubernetes Cluster; Step 06 - Quick Look at Kubernetes Concepts - Pods, Replica Sets and Deployment; Step 07 - Understanding Pods in Kubernetes So this is a mix of the Docker and Kubernetes information posts Configuring Microsoft Active Directory Federation Service (SAML) Microsoft adfs setup yaml \ --version 7 Each pod would be on it's own kubernetes node (VM or physical machine) It covers almost all the use cases and can be more flexible than Docker Swarm Product Key Windows 10 It covers almost . Provide a name for the deployment and the container image to deploy. kubernetes helps you manage applications that are made up of hundreds or maybe thousands of containers. Step 6 - Deploy to Kubernetes Cluster. About the Tutorial Kubernetes is a container management technology developed in Google lab to manage containerized applications in different kind of environments such as physical, virtual, and . Kubernetes will automatically pick Docker as the default container runtime. The Kubernetes Architects have done a good job in abstracting away the volume technology from the POD. Make sure that the apt package is working. This tutorial will help in understanding the concepts of container management using Kubernetes. In today's world, automation taking place at a brisk pace across industries, especially in the tech space, domestic software firms, are set to slash headcounts by a massive 3 million by 2022! This deployment allows Istio to extract a wealth of signals about .
After listening to Kubernetes: A Step-by-Step Guide to Learn and Master Kubernetes, it provides a more practical understanding of the 'how,' as the title suggests, in terms of practice patterns. Here we use an image that will run the Nginx web server: kubectl.exe create deployment my-nginx --image nginx Create a Kubernetes secret containing the service account keys: kubectl create secret generic stackdriver-webhook-bridge --from-file=key Prepare Install the kubernetes dashboard scegligaggiano Veeam The Operation Has Timed Out Deploy and configure a Keycloak instance onto our OpenShift Kubernetes distribution, just next to the fruits-catalog . Please follow the tutorial step by step to understand so that you can grasp the entire concept behind the Kubernetes. . Build, deploy and manage your applications across cloud- and on-premise infrastructure See full list on baeldung Legal Notice Quickstarts come in a variety of languages and frameworks, and are defined in a template, which is constructed from a set of services, build configurations, and deployment configurations OpenShift tutorials To better understand how the Red .
Integration with some AWS services like CloudTrail, CloudWatch , ELB, IAM, VPC, PrivateLink. Provide the name of the existing cluster and click Next. In this page we're compiled all the valuable Kubernetes tutorials from multiple sources - from the big players like Google, Amazon and Microsoft, to individual bloggers and community members.